Forty girls attended the classes regularly, learning some basic writing, reading and mathematic skills. Now that the first phase of the project has concluded, the seven girls with the best results will now integrate into the standard educational system from October 2007.
The closing ceremony of the project was held on October 17th, coinciding with the International Day for the Eradication of Poverty. Phase Two will commence in December 2007 with the same group of girls, plus a second group.
The project costs of $1,530 were sponsored by fundraising activities organized by UNV, which sold cards, bookmarks and handcraft bags.
